1
0
mirror of https://github.com/ManyakRus/starter.git synced 2025-11-26 23:10:42 +02:00

сделал Set_FieldFromEnv_Date()

This commit is contained in:
Nikitin Aleksandr
2024-11-29 14:33:29 +03:00
parent 8ba0b6188b
commit 096981fc07
5 changed files with 243 additions and 2 deletions

View File

@@ -857,6 +857,13 @@ func ShowTimePassed(StartAt time.Time) {
fmt.Printf("Time passed: %s\n", time.Since(StartAt))
}
// ShowTimePassed_FormatText - показывает время прошедшее с момента старта
// запускать:
// defer micro.ShowTimePassed(time.Now())
func ShowTimePassed_FormatText(FormatText string, StartAt time.Time) {
fmt.Printf(FormatText, time.Since(StartAt))
}
// ShowTimePassedSeconds - показывает время секунд прошедшее с момента старта
// запускать:
// defer micro.ShowTimePassedSeconds(time.Now())
@@ -1350,7 +1357,8 @@ func SetFieldValue(Object any, FieldName string, Value any) error {
}
prop := ref.FieldByName(FieldName)
prop.Set(reflect.ValueOf(Value))
ValueNew := reflect.ValueOf(Value)
prop.Set(ValueNew)
return err
}